Principal Structural Engineer

Johnson Service Group (JSG) is actively searching for a Principal Structural Engineer for our client's operation near Elkview / Charleston, WV. This is a long-term contract position with competitive pay. This is a fantastic opportunity to work on a state-of-the-art project.

The Principal Structural Engineer will lead the analysis and design of structures and foundations for large-scale chemical and power subsector projects. This role combines technical expertise with leadership responsibilities, ensuring compliance with ASCE, AISC, IBC, and ACI standards while guiding project teams from concept through execution.

Qualifications:

  • 15+ years of progressive civil/structural engineering experience.
  • Bachelor's degree in Civil or Structural Engineering.
  • Professional Engineer (PE) license preferred.
  • Advanced knowledge of structural codes and standards including IBC, ASCE 7, ACI, AISC, and PIP.
  • Proficiency in structural analysis/design software (STAAD Pro, RISA 3D).
  • Familiarity with Tekla, Navisworks, AutoCAD, and Microsoft Office tools.
  • Strong ability to interpret and develop civil/structural drawings and specifications.
  • Proven ability to lead mid-size projects and multidisciplinary teams.
  • Strong communication skills with the ability to work effectively with clients, stakeholders, and colleagues.
